PATH:
usr
/
lib64
/
python2.7
/
test
� ��^c @ s� d d l m Z d d l Z d d l Z d d l Z d e f d � � YZ d e j f d � � YZ d � Z e d k r� e � n d S( i����( t test_supportNt CompleteMec B s e Z d Z d Z RS( s6 Trivial class used in testing rlcompleter.Completer. i ( t __name__t __module__t __doc__t spam( ( ( s- /usr/lib64/python2.7/test/test_rlcompleter.pyR s t TestRlcompleterc B s5 e Z d � Z d � Z d � Z d � Z d � Z RS( c C sM t j � | _ t j t d t d t d t � � | _ | j j d d � d S( NR t eggR t i ( t rlcompletert Completert stdcompletert dictt intt strR t completert complete( t self( ( s- /usr/lib64/python2.7/test/test_rlcompleter.pyt setUp s c C s� d t f d � � Y} d t f d � � Y} | j | j j � | j | j j � | j t j | � � j � | j t t j | d � � d S( Nt Ac B s e Z RS( ( R R ( ( ( s- /usr/lib64/python2.7/test/test_rlcompleter.pyR s t Bc B s e Z RS( ( R R ( ( ( s- /usr/lib64/python2.7/test/test_rlcompleter.pyR s i ( i ( R t listt assertTrueR t use_main_nst assertFalseR R R t assertRaisest TypeError( R R R ( ( s- /usr/lib64/python2.7/test/test_rlcompleter.pyt test_namespace s c C s | j t | j j d � � g t t � D] } | j d � r( | d ^ q( � | j t | j j d � � g t t � D] } | j d � rv | d ^ qv � | j | j j d � g � | j | j j d � d g � | j | j j d � d g � | j | j j d � d g � d S( Nt dit (t stt akaksajadhakt CompleteMs CompleteMe(t egs egg(( t assertEqualt sortedR t global_matchest dirt builtinst startswithR ( R t x( ( s- /usr/lib64/python2.7/test/test_rlcompleter.pyt test_global_matches s 33 c C s | j | j j d � g t t � D]$ } | j d � r"